We have been pumping money into Haiti for many years actually, and of course (like New Orleans) they are in a storm/flooding or earthquake area.  How much relief money did New Orleans get say from Haiti.... or how many other countries??  Haiti is a country, and the Capital Port Au Prince area suffered the earthquake, not the entire country.  The population estimate for Haiti (the country) is roughly 9 million and not everyone in the country suffered damage of the earthquake.  

The International Red Cross estimated that about three million people were affected by the quake;[8] Haitian President Rene Preval stated on 27 January that "nearly 170,000" bodies had been counted.[9] The New York Times reported on 28 January that 20,000 commercial buildings and 225,000 residences had collapsed or were severely damaged.[10]
